a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orsefidel <contact@sefidel.net>2024-08-04 22:14:32 +0900
committersefidel <contact@sefidel.net>2024-08-06 16:01:39 +0900
commitb675bd54bd5bf96cbc326ea62a0549338aa27156 (patch)
tree03d11ba1bff275ab92c0743f337ac1cb2600c3d9
parentf32cda5a3179fdce587349e8014fa2ee012de4ee (diff)
downloadnixrc-b675bd54bd5bf96cbc326ea62a0549338aa27156.zip
feat(modules/secure-boot)!: import lanzaboot inside module
-rw-r--r--modules/secure-boot.nix6
-rw-r--r--nixos/default.nix1
2 files changed, 5 insertions, 2 deletions
diff --git a/modules/secure-boot.nix b/modules/secure-boot.nix
index 72f2d83..7f079e4 100644
--- a/modules/secure-boot.nix
+++ b/modules/secure-boot.nix
@@ -1,9 +1,13 @@
-{ config, pkgs, lib, ... }:
+{ config, inputs, pkgs, lib, ... }:
let
cfg = config.modules.secure-boot;
in
{
+ imports = [
+ inputs.lanzaboote.nixosModules.lanzaboote
+ ];
+
options.modules.secure-boot = {
enable = lib.mkEnableOption "Secure boot with lanzaboote";
};
diff --git a/nixos/default.nix b/nixos/default.nix
index 16e3cbf..599ba75 100644
--- a/nixos/default.nix
+++ b/nixos/default.nix
@@ -15,7 +15,6 @@
name = "haruka";
nixpkgs = unstable;
extraModules = [
- inputs.lanzaboote.nixosModules.lanzaboote
inputs.sops-nix.nixosModules.sops
inputs.impermanence.nixosModules.impermanence
inputs.attic.nixosModules.atticd